Mario Kart Arcade GP DX stands as one of the most exhilarating entries in the Mario Kart series, blending classic Nintendo charm with the high-octane spectacle of Namco’s arcade engineering. While traditionally found in family entertainment centers and arcades like Dave & Buster's, the quest for a "Mario Kart Arcade GP DX USA ROM" has become a holy grail for home emulation enthusiasts.

The configuration is highly desirable for English-speaking players. While the game data itself often contains multiple language assets, specific region cracks, configuration files, and launch wrappers are required to force the game to boot into the English/North American arcade profile. This unlocks translated menus, English voiceovers, and standard regional settings. Software Requirements for Emulation
